Tracheobronchopathia osteochondroplastica: a case report

Abstract

Tracheobronchopathia osteochondroplastica (TO) is a rare disorder with unknown aetiology. In this paper, a case with TO was presented. A 77 year-old-man was admitted with cough for 2 years. Chest X-ray showed interstitial changes. Computed tomography of thorax demonstrated calcific density lesion in the trachea and in the left and right main bronchi. Fiberoptic bronchoscopy revealed numerous white, hard, irregular nodules on the anterior and lateral walls of trachea and on main bronchi. Pathologic diagnosis of bronchoscopic biopsy was TO.
